Murals at Rainbow

Murals have an important place in Rainbow's infrastructure. Not only do the beautify the space, but they allow local (and sometimes far away) artists to show off their talents and express ideas through their art. We are proud to showcase some award winning art on our walls.

Precita Eyes

The mural at the front of the store (opposite the registers) was painted by local artists from Precita Eyes. Created to honor farm workers and the earth, it was completed just in time for the grand opening of our new Folsom Street location back in April, 1996.

Creativity Explored
The mural above the produce area is a collaborative work between Creativity Explored and Rainbow workers. In 1998 Alicia McCarthy and Eric Dekker (two Rainbow workers) painted the top half of the mural; Creativity Explored painted the bottom panels along with the Rainbow artists.

Sama Sama/Together
The Trainor Alley Mural is one of three San Francisco murals created as part of the Sama-Sama/Together project. The Rainbow site is the only mural that is the direct result of the collaboration between local U.S. artists and the Indonesian artist collective, Apotik Komik. Alicia McCarthy, from our produce department contributed to bringing the project here to Rainbow as well as the creation of the mural. The project garnered the 2004 Precita Eyes International Mural Award.
